Muzzik likes: Miley Cyrus releases “Secrets” with Lindsey Buckingham & Mick Fleetwood

A heartfelt song dedicated to her dad

On September 18, 2025, Miley Cyrus released “Secrets”, featuring Fleetwood Mac legends Lindsey Buckingham and Mick Fleetwood. The track is part of the deluxe edition of her album Something Beautiful. 

“Secrets” is an intimate ballad in which Miley expresses her wish for her father, Billy Ray Cyrus, to share hidden truths—no matter how painful. She describes the song as a “peace offering,” emphasizing themes of forgiveness and the idea that healing begins when we allow vulnerability. 

The collaboration with Buckingham (guitar) and Fleetwood (drums) lends the song a cross-generational resonance, bridging her own musical identity with the enduring legacy of Fleetwood Mac. The production is handled by Miley alongside Jonathan Rado, Michael Pollack, and Shawn Everett, maintaining an emotional intensity and rich musical texture.

The music video for “Secrets” is co-directed by Miley Cyrus, Jacob Bixenman, and Brendan Walter. It was filmed at the historic Million Dollar Theatre in Los Angeles, which adds a layer of grandeur and nostalgic flair to the visuals.
